Dave Horsley from Sharp Microsystems introduces a novel ultrasound technology using micro machined ultrasonic transducers. He explains that ultrasound consists of high-frequency pressure waves, which are inaudible to humans. The technology uses multiple transducers to emit pulses and measure echoes, similar to GPS triangulation, allowing for precise range measurements. This innovation adds a third dimension to device interaction, enabling users to interact with devices without physical contact.
